> FYI - MediaWiki upgrades can be a real nightmare. I personally moved away
> from MediaWiki because I let mine get too old and the "jump through"
> versions needed to make it current weren't even available anymore. I'm
> using FosWiki for LPKY. It is a branch of TkWiki from before it went
> commercial. https://foswiki.org/

>>>>>>>>>> Okay I spoke with James, and here is a suggested Motion to get
>>>>>>>>>> the ball rolling on this with minimal staff time:
>>>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>>>> =====
>>>>>>>>>> Move that an LPedia Historical Committee of three members be
>>>>>>>>>> established with the first member to be James Gholston. The Committee
>>>>>>>>>> would have the authority to select a new hosting location for LPedia.org at
>>>>>>>>>> a cost of up to $200 per year to be paid by the LNC and will
>>>>>>>>>> have full access and control of the new hosting location along with the
>>>>>>>>>> LNC. At a date to be determined by the Committee, close LPedia.org to new
>>>>>>>>>> edits and copy the MySQL database for LPedia.org, separating it out out if
>>>>>>>>>> it is integrated with other databases. The LNC will authorize
>>>>>>>>>> solicitations to be made via LP News or other LP controlled outlets for
>>>>>>>>>> Committee members and volunteers to duplicate the site, and the Committee
>>>>>>>>>> may make recommendations or request additional funds if a database vendor
>>>>>>>>>> needs to be retained to make this move. Upon successful transfer of the
>>>>>>>>>> wiki to its new hosting location, LPedia.org and any alternate domain names
>>>>>>>>>> are to point to the new location, and upon confirmation of success the
>>>>>>>>>> legacy hosting location may be shut down. This database and all LPedia
>>>>>>>>>> files and directories are to be given to a team of volunteers selected by
>>>>>>>>>> the Committee who will be entrusted to set up and maintain LPedia.org in
>>>>>>>>>> its new location, and the Committee will be dissolved.
